Abstract

The present invention proposes a high-nitrogen organic wastewater membrane filtration concentrate advanced treatment system and method, including: a water storage tank, an adsorption reaction tank, a coagulation tank, a sedimentation tank, an intermediate water tank, an MBR reaction tank and an electrocatalytic oxidation reaction tank; wherein, The water storage tank is connected with the adsorption reaction tank through a centrifugal pump; the effluent of the adsorption reaction tank enters the coagulation tank through the centrifugal pump, enters the sedimentation tank, and then flows into the intermediate pool; the effluent of the intermediate pool is continuously Flow into the MBR reaction pool, the MBR reaction pool includes a membrane pool, and the ultrafiltration membrane is set in the membrane pool; the effluent of the MBR reaction pool is lifted into the electrocatalytic oxidation reaction pool by a centrifugal pump, and the electrocatalytic oxidation reaction pool is equipped with positive and negative An electrode and a power supply are provided, and a circulation pump is provided to circulate the liquid in the electrocatalytic oxidation reaction cell. The COD and TN removal rate in the concentrated solution is high, the effluent water quality can meet the discharge standards, no pollutants can be completely removed, and there is no secondary pollution and pollutant transfer.

Technical field

[0001] The present invention relates to the deep treatment of membrane filtration concentrates of high nitrogen organic wastewater, in particular to the deep treatment of landfill leachate concentrates. Background

[0002] With the increasingly stringent discharge standards for landfill leachate and industrial wastewater treatment, nanofiltration, reverse osmosis and other treatment units have become the deep treatment process after the biochemical treatment of landfill leachate and industrial wastewater. Although this treatment process can make the leachate treatment and the effluent index after industrial wastewater basically meet the requirements of the discharge standard, the membrane filtration does not degrade toxic and harmful pollutants, but only enriches and concentrates them, and as a by-product of membrane treatment, the concentrate will cause greater harm to the environment.
